The Fluke 5626-12-G Secondary PRT Probe is engineered for high-accuracy temperature measurement in laboratories and industrial calibration environments. With a 1/4″ diameter and 12″ length, it is compatible with standard calibration wells, providing consistent and dependable readings. Its durable, chemically resistant construction ensures long-term performance in demanding environments. Ideal for research labs, industrial metrology, and calibration facilities, this probe is an essential tool for precise, repeatable temperature monitoring and calibration tasks.
Key Features:
100 Ω platinum resistance sensor for precise temperature measurement
1/4″ diameter x 12″ length suitable for standard calibration wells
Wide operating temperature range for versatile applications
Durable and chemically resistant construction for long-term use
Quick response time for efficient calibration
